Contract Overview:
Golden Dome is a national-level, whole-of-nation initiative in which you will play a critical role in advancing next-generation homeland defense capabilities. If you are seeking a fast-paced position focused on developing innovative software for the Space-Based Interceptor mission, this opportunity is designed for you.
Key Responsibilities:
System Development and Integration
- Design and develop space systems with a focus on navigation, targeting, and interceptor functionality.
- Perform system-level requirements analysis, flow-down, and validation to ensure compliance with customer specifications.
- Work collaboratively with other engineering disciplines (payload, propulsion, guidance and control, etc.) to maintain system performance standards and achieve mission objectives.
Testing and Evaluation
- Conduct engineering and qualification testing of various components and subsystems to validate performance under space conditions.
- Support integration, test planning, execution, and verification activities for full-system and subsystem evaluations.
- Analyze test data and apply findings to optimize system designs.
- Simulation and Modeling
- Develop simulations for operational scenarios, including guidance, navigation, and tracking performance.
- Leverage modeling tools to predict capabilities and failure modes for space-based interceptor systems.
Risk Assessment and Mitigation
- Identify technical risks associated with space system development and deployment and propose mitigation plans.
- Support trade studies to evaluate system alternatives and recommend solutions to enhance mission success.
- Lifecycle Sustainment
- Lead efforts in sustaining space systems, ensuring reliability and functionality over the mission lifecycle.
- Adapt existing designs and technologies to address emerging threats and mission evolutions.
Collaboration and Documentation
- Work closely with DoD customers, stakeholders, and contractors to ensure alignment with mission goals.
- Prepare technical documentation including system design reviews, test reports, and operational manuals tailored for defense applications.
Required Qualifications:
Education and Experience:
Bachelor's degree with 15 years' related experience; Master's degree preferred.
Required Security Clearance:
- Must have an Active Top-Secret Clearance with SCI Eligibility
- 5 years' prior experience for access to Special Access Program Information (SAP), or Controlled Access Program (CAP); must have 1 year in the last 5 years.
Technical Expertise:
- Expertise in space mission architectures, orbital mechanics, and subsystem design.
- Familiarity with missile defense systems and space-based technologies.
- Proficient in systems engineering tools (e.g., MATLAB, SysML, STK) and CAD software.
- Strong knowledge of government standards and practices for DoD space systems
- Experience in guidance, navigation, and control systems for interceptors or similar defense platforms.
- Hands-on experience in space hardware integration and flight qualification.
- Knowledge of emerging threats in space and counter-space capabilities.
